Job Title: Fashion & Fabric Designer Intern
Company: Feydor
Location: Bengaluru, Karnataka, India
Employment Type: Internship (3 Months)
Workplace Type: On-site
Stipend: Paid Internship
About Feydor:
Feydor is a newly launched fashion label based in Bengaluru, dedicated to bold creativity, modern aesthetics, and meaningful design. As an early-stage startup, we are building our team from the ground up and are looking for passionate, imaginative individuals who want to make their mark. You will have the opportunity to help define the brand's visual and material language from its very beginning.
Position Overview:
We seek a Fashion & Fabric Designer Intern to join our founding creative team at Feydor. This dynamic role combines fashion and textile design, allowing you to explore everything from silhouettes and garment structures to textures, surface design, and prints. As an integral part of a newly launched brand, you will have significant creative freedom to express your ideas, experiment with design concepts, and contribute to the visual identity of Feydor's debut collections. You will work hands-on with materials, sketches, and sampling in a collaborative and supportive environment where originality and innovation are highly encouraged.
Key Responsibilities:
Assist in designing original apparel pieces aligned with Feydor's brand identity.
Research and develop unique fabric concepts, surface textures, and print ideas.
Create mood boards, digital illustrations, colour palettes, and technical sketches.
Support in sourcing materials, selecting textiles, and liaising with vendors.
Assist in garment construction planning, sampling, and fitting processes.
Collaborate on photoshoots, lookbooks, and visual merchandising concepts.
Stay up-to-date with fashion and fabric trends to inspire design decisions.
Contribute ideas actively in a creative, fast-moving startup environment.
Candidate Profile:
Currently pursuing or recently graduated with a degree/diploma in Fashion Design, Textile Design, or a related field.
Passionate about both garment design and fabric innovation.
Familiar with Adobe Illustrator, Photoshop, or other relevant design tools.
Creative, self-motivated, and eager to take initiative in a startup setting.
Strong attention to detail and a good sense of colour, form, and fabric behaviour.
Excellent communication and teamwork skills.
What You Will Gain:
A unique opportunity to co-build a fashion brand from its inception.
Creative freedom and direct involvement in end-to-end design processes.
Real-world portfolio work with tangible contributions to live collections.
Daily mentorship from the founders and exposure to multiple aspects of the brand.
Certificate of internship upon completion.
Potential for long-term employment based on performance.
